+// Keep in sync with View.java:LAYER_TYPE_*
+enum LayerType {
+    kLayerTypeNone = 0,
+    // Although we cannot build the software layer directly (must be done at
+    // record time), this information is used when applying alpha.
+    kLayerTypeSoftware = 1,
+    kLayerTypeRenderLayer = 2,
+    // TODO: LayerTypeSurfaceTexture? Maybe?
+};
+
+class ANDROID_API LayerProperties {
+public:
+    bool setType(LayerType type) {
+        if (RP_SET(mType, type)) {
+            reset();
+            return true;
+        }
+        return false;
+    }
+
+    LayerType type() const {
+        return mType;
+    }
+
+    bool setOpaque(bool opaque) {
+        return RP_SET(mOpaque, opaque);
+    }
+
+    bool opaque() const {
+        return mOpaque;
+    }
+
+    bool setAlpha(uint8_t alpha) {
+        return RP_SET(mAlpha, alpha);
+    }
+
+    uint8_t alpha() const {
+        return mAlpha;
+    }
+
+    bool setXferMode(SkXfermode::Mode mode) {
+        return RP_SET(mMode, mode);
+    }
+
+    SkXfermode::Mode xferMode() const {
+        return mMode;
+    }
+
+    bool setColorFilter(SkColorFilter* filter);
+
+    SkColorFilter* colorFilter() const {
+        return mColorFilter;
+    }
+
+    // Sets alpha, xfermode, and colorfilter from an SkPaint
+    // paint may be NULL, in which case defaults will be set
+    bool setFromPaint(const SkPaint* paint);
+
+    bool needsBlending() const {
+        return !opaque() || alpha() < 255;
+    }
+
+    LayerProperties& operator=(const LayerProperties& other);
+
+private:
+    LayerProperties();
+    ~LayerProperties();
+    void reset();
+
+    friend class RenderProperties;
+
+    LayerType mType;
+    // Whether or not that Layer's content is opaque, doesn't include alpha
+    bool mOpaque;
+    uint8_t mAlpha;
+    SkXfermode::Mode mMode;
+    SkColorFilter* mColorFilter;
+};
